Roberto Will become worse for while, but we are also seeing huge reaction from inside US, so my expectation will be only mild changes on the Internet, if any ( more probably) , and in the free circulation of people to and from US. I do not believe that jurisdiction of ICANN will affect more than normally happens related to visa issues, other countries do have restrictions too and some are more unpredictable then US. If it will happen any relevant interference on Internet ( $ power will forbid, I believe)then will be time to rethink the jurisdiction. Till then I do not believe in huge impact.
